  2. He doesn't have to get outside the tackle before he cuts. Especially after he's run the search play off tackle almost every time we've run it. The wider he stretches the play without attacking the depth of the defence the less likely he is to gain positive yards because he is wasting all his energy running sideline to sideline while drawing every defender closing all the cutback lanes. Unless the play is misdirection or contain is broken he shouldn't be taking every search play off tackle. Simply, Simpson needs to make better reads, and honestly I think he is pressing way too hard to make big plays, and putting the offence is 2nd and very long all the time. Maybe he needs prescribed running plays.

  4. That's not how I'm seeing it. I see us running a zone scheme where it is up to Simpson to pick a gap and make a cut to get upfield, he keeps charging off-tackle and dancing behind the line trying to win the race to the sideline. I'd like to see him make one cut and pound it up inside, much like he did for parts of last season and how Garrett did in 2011. The indecisive way he's running now it's either a home run or a 2 yard loss, and that just isn't going to cut it.

  21. Good offenses keep defenses off balance. You need to have strong run formations, you need to run from them and show you can pass from them too. You need strong pass formations, you need to show you can run from them too. Our offence right now is very predictable, any playaction or read plays we use are slow developing at 5 yards depth in our backfield, really just bogging down our offence and not fooling anyone. Do the basics well and mix it up.
